About This Item

Sausalito, CA: Angel Island Publications, 1963. 1st edition. Soft cover. Very Good/No Jacket (as issued). VG. 4to, 80pp, printed wrappers. A densely packed magazine-format issue of this high-quality cultural review. Includes a full-page ad for Thomas Pynchon's V. (nicely printed on white paper), an early short piece on Black literature by Ed Bullins, a Richard Kostelanetz piece on Legman's Love and Death, other interesting content. Tiny penciled issue number to front cover (else unmarked), a little reading wear and outer rubbing, one page has minor soil, subscription cards removed at back of issue (inside, does not affect cover).
